Man charged in connection with Texas fishing tournament fraud

A man is accused of fraud for violating rules in a high school fishing tournament. Ryan Lovelace was the supervisor for the team of students in the competition. He’s charged with “freshwater fish tournament fraud,” a Class A misdemeanor in the Parks and Wildlife Department. Lake Conroe to host Bass Pro Tour Major League fishing tournament

Conroe City Council voted unanimously to approve $20,000 from the hotel occupancy tax to market and host the Bass Pro Tour Major League Fishing Tournament at its meeting Dec. 13. The tournament is planned to be held on Lake Conroe in February as the second venue for Major League Fishing’s eight-event tour.
